Sipalay City
Sipalay City sits on the coast of Negros Occidental in the Philippines, facing the Sulu Sea. It’s a quiet coastal town known more for its laid-back atmosphere and nearby dive access than for a large, resident dive scene. With one local dive center and a few nearby access points, most diving here entails short trips to surrounding sites along the Sulu Sea and nearby reefs, suitable for day trips and casual divers. Water is typically warm and tropical, with visibility and current conditions varying by season; expect gentle drift & ramping conditions near shore, and reef structures offshore that attract small reef fish and occasional macro life. For divers, the area provides a gateway to regional dive opportunities rather than a dense, built-out dive hub.
